The root canal is a treatment where the tooth is saved instead of removing damaged or infected teeth. The word “root canal” comes from the cleanliness of canals(Nerves) inside the root of the tooth. Decades ago, root canal treatment was a painful treatment. But with the help of new technology and local anesthetics, there is no pain in this treatment, a slight discomfort can occur though.

How is RCT done?

The tooth has 3 parts, the outer part is enamel, the main part of the tooth is dentin and then the soft pulp of the tooth. The vein and blood vessels enter from the root of the teeth (Apex) and passing through the root canal and reached the pulp chamber. The pulp chamber is within the crown of the teeth. The canal is opened by drilling from the upper part of the infected tooth i.e. the crown. In the root canal treatment, the infected pulp is removed. To further clean and medicate the tooth hydrogen peroxide and sodium hypo chloride is sent through a microneedle in the veins and these veins are disconnected from the blood supply. The tooth is sealed with a silver filling or tooth color filling. To strengthen the teeth, after the root canal treatment it is necessary to apply a cap or crown on it.

No, an infected tooth cannot heal itself. In fact, the infection can spread to other areas of your jaw causing serious pain. Treating an infected tooth requires medications or root canal treatment.

No, a root canal treatment is pain-free. Before proceeding with the root canal treatment, a dentist will use local anaesthesia to numb the infected area ensuring a painless treatment.

Once the root canal treatment is completed, the treated tooth will heal within a few days. Patients might experience some pain once they awaken from anaesthesia; this is likely to end within a few days due to medication.

Most root canal treatment can be successfully completed by a dentist in a single day. In certain cases of serious infection or back tooth, a dentist may give 2-3 days appointment for finishing the treatment.
